The Philippines, with its vast coastline of over 36,000 kilometers, has long relied on its maritime sector as a cornerstone of economic growth. Manila, as the country’s capital and primary port city, serves as the epicenter for maritime trade and shipbuilding activities. The demand for qualified Marine Engineers in this dynamic environment is immense, driven by factors such as port modernization, ship repair services, and compliance with international shipping regulations. This Undergraduate Thesis aims to explore how a Marine Engineer navigates these challenges while contributing to the safety, efficiency, and environmental sustainability of Manila’s maritime infrastructure.

The role of a Marine Engineer extends beyond ship design and maintenance; it encompasses systems engineering, propulsion technologies, and marine environmental management. In the Philippines, where the maritime industry is heavily influenced by geopolitical factors and climate change vulnerabilities, Marine Engineers must balance technical innovation with ecological preservation (Dizon & Reyes, 2021). Manila’s strategic location along major shipping lanes has positioned it as a key player in regional trade networks. However, the city faces challenges such as port congestion and coastal pollution, which require tailored engineering solutions.

Academic institutions in Manila, including the University of Santo Tomas and Mindanao State University – Iligan Institute of Technology (MSU-IIT), offer programs that prepare students for careers as Marine Engineers. These programs emphasize both theoretical knowledge and practical training in shipbuilding, naval architecture, and marine systems management. However, gaps remain between curricula and industry needs, particularly in areas like renewable energy integration and digitalization of maritime operations.

4.1 Port Infrastructure Demands
Manila’s ports handle millions of containers annually, requiring continuous upgrades to infrastructure and equipment. Marine Engineers play a pivotal role in ensuring that cranes, conveyor systems, and cargo handling technologies meet safety standards while minimizing environmental impact.

4.2 Environmental Regulation Compliance
The Philippines is a signatory to the MARPOL Convention, which regulates marine pollution. Marine Engineers must ensure ships operating in Manila’s waters comply with regulations on ballast water management, fuel efficiency, and emissions control.

4.3 Climate Change Adaptation
Rising sea levels and increased typhoon activity necessitate resilient engineering solutions for coastal facilities. Marine Engineers are tasked with designing structures that can withstand extreme weather events while preserving marine ecosystems.
